Through work we have been asked to sell some Tamiya stuff. There is a sad story behind it which I will come to.
In short, we have 2 Tamiya blazing blazer kits(as well as some other stuff). Both of which are brand new. Boxes can ony be described as mint, none of the packaging has been opened and are believed to be complete. Without getting too involved it's quite hard to tell.
The story goes, An old couple bought them to us, they then explained how they came about them.
Their son, got his first job working in a model shop. He loved his models. All his wages were spent in the shop where he worked(I'm sure the shop loved that!) he was 16. He was then diagnosed with a brain tumour. He passed away aged 17. That was 28 years ago.
These models have been in his parents loft ever since he died. They haven't even looked at them since putting them Away!
Obviously for them, it is very difficult to get rid of it all. They have no idea of value and to be frank, neither do I. They may only be worth £10 they may also be worth hundreds, I don't know. Can any of you give me a rough guesstimate of what they may be worth?
Modern RC I am fine with as I raced 1/8th nitro buggies and flew planes but this older stuff seems a bit of a lottery.
They are a lovely old couple and I'd really like to do my best with them.
Thanks in advance for any information you can give me.

I am happy to tell you they have both been sold. Even better than I could have expected thanks to you guys!
We did have a couple of PHers attend.
One kit sold for £1350 plus the fee's to one of our regular buyers. As it turns out, this one had a little damage to the blister pack.
The other sold too but as I believe it was a fellow PHer bought it, I won't disclose how much for. If he would like to share that with you, then no doubt he will.
All the other RC stuff entered by them also sold extremely well. This included lots of Tamiya parts. I think the vendors will be very happy!

I haven't spoken to the vendors personally(been busy having 2 auctions per week, tonight I broke my personal highest sale price at £11200+vat, you can always rely on a hilux!) but I kind of want to hand deliver their cheque myself!
Having a quick look through the figures today, from a boot full of "junk" they were half expecting to take to the tip, they will be recieveing a cheque for over £3200 with the fees deducted.
There was one other Tamiya model that made £70 or £80, I don't know what it was but it was 1/24 scale and a Porsche shell. I really liked it so I may have to find one myself! There was also a box with 2 incomplete cars(1/10 buggies of some sort) which made £310. I wish I knew more about this stuff!
I am genuinely over the moon for them!
